Identical twins (also called monozygotic twins) result from the fertilization of a single egg by a single sperm, with the fertilized egg then splitting into two. Leah and Ava Clements Age and Birthday. Leah … grain wood furniture shaker platform bedWeb16 jul. 2024 · What percentage of the world is identical twins? Incidence. Monozygotic twinning occurs in birthing at a rate of about 3 in every 1000 deliveries worldwide (about 0.3% of the world population). The likelihood of a single fertilization resulting in monozygotic twins is uniformly distributed in all populations around the world. grain wife
